编程中分号什么时候输入

worktile 其他 71

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,分号是用来表示语句结束的标志。具体来说,分号的输入时机取决于编程语言的语法规则。

    大多数编程语言,如C、C++、Java、Python等,都要求在每条语句的末尾加上分号。这样做可以告诉编译器或解释器,当前语句已经结束,接下来要处理下一条语句。

    在C语言中,例如:

    int a = 10; // 声明一个变量并赋值
    printf("Hello, World!"); // 输出字符串
    

    在这个例子中,每条语句都以分号结束。

    然而,也有一些编程语言不需要在每条语句的末尾加分号。例如,在Python中,分号只是用来分隔多个语句的,不是必需的。以下是Python的示例:

    a = 10 # 声明一个变量并赋值
    print("Hello, World!") # 输出字符串
    

    在这个例子中,分号只是用来分隔两条语句,并不是必须的。

    需要注意的是,不同的编程语言有不同的语法规则,所以在编写代码时,要根据具体的编程语言来确定是否需要输入分号。同时,正确的使用分号也是编写高质量代码的重要方面之一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,分号是用来表示语句的结束。它的输入方式取决于编程语言的语法规则。下面是一些常见的情况:

    1. 行末分号:大多数编程语言要求在每个语句的末尾加上分号。这样做可以明确地告诉编译器或解释器这是一个完整的语句。例如,在C、C++、Java、JavaScript等语言中,每个语句都需要以分号结尾。

    2. 块语句分号:有些编程语言允许在块语句(例如if语句、循环语句、函数定义等)的末尾加上分号。这样做可以将多个语句合并为一个单独的语句。例如,在C、C++中,可以在if语句的末尾加上分号将其转化为单独的语句块。

    3. 函数调用分号:在某些编程语言中,函数调用的语法要求在函数名后加上一对圆括号,函数调用的参数可以放在括号内。例如,在C、C++、Java中,函数调用需要以分号结尾。

    4. 结构体或类定义分号:在某些编程语言中,当定义结构体或类时,每个成员之间需要用分号分隔。例如,在C、C++中,定义结构体的语法要求在每个成员之间加上分号。

    5. 注释分号:在某些编程语言中,分号可以用来表示注释的开始。注释是一种用于解释或描述代码的文本,编译器或解释器会忽略它们。例如,在C、C++中,可以使用//或/* /来注释代码,其中//后的内容或/ */之间的内容都会被忽略。

    总之,分号的输入方式取决于编程语言的语法规则和上下文。正确使用分号可以帮助编译器或解释器正确解析代码,避免语法错误。因此,在编程中,根据语言规范和具体情况,正确地输入分号是非常重要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,分号是一种用于表示语句结束的符号。它告诉编译器或解释器在哪里结束当前语句并开始下一条语句。在大多数编程语言中,分号是必需的,但也有一些特殊情况例外。

    下面是一些关于在编程中输入分号的常见情况和规则。

    1. 语句结束:在大多数编程语言中,每条语句都需要以分号结尾。这包括赋值语句、函数调用、条件语句等等。例如,在C语言中,赋值语句通常以分号结尾:

      int x = 10; // 赋值语句以分号结束
      

      如果忘记输入分号,编译器会报错并指出缺少分号的位置。

    2. 块语句:在某些编程语言中,例如C、C++和Java,块语句(用花括号括起来的一组语句)不需要以分号结尾。只有块语句外的每条语句才需要分号。

      if (x > 0) { // 块语句,不需要分号
          // 一些语句
      }
      
    3. 注释:在大多数编程语言中,注释是用来解释代码的说明文本,并不被编译器或解释器执行。在某些语言中,注释之后的分号是可选的,但在其他语言中是必需的。例如,在C语言中:

      int x = 10; // 这是一个赋值语句,分号是必需的
      

      有些编程规范建议在注释之后添加分号,以避免在注释被删除或修改时引起语法错误。

    4. 控制结构:在某些编程语言中,控制结构(例如if语句、for循环、while循环等)的条件部分和主体部分之间需要使用分号分隔。

      for (int i = 0; i < 10; i++) { // 分号分隔条件和主体部分
          // 循环体
      }
      

      这种用法确保编译器将条件部分和主体部分视为两个独立的语句。

    5. 函数声明和定义:在某些编程语言中,函数声明和函数定义需要以分号结尾。

      void foo(); // 函数声明,需要分号
      
      void foo() { // 函数定义,不需要分号
          // 函数体
      }
      

    总之,在编程中,我们需要根据语言规范和语法要求来决定何时输入分号。它的位置和使用是非常重要的,它能够帮助我们正确解析和执行代码。因此,了解和遵守分号的正确用法是编写高质量代码的重要一步。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部